Second-Story Home Addition In Progress Elmhurst, IL

Home addition in progress with new second-story framing, rebuilt front porch, and exterior structural work

This project was a major structural addition where we took an existing brick home and expanded it upward with a full second-story build while also rebuilding the front porch. A big part of the job was making the new work look like it belonged on the original house, so we focused on tying the rooflines together, carrying the proportions correctly, and keeping the front elevation balanced instead of making the addition feel top-heavy. At this stage you can see the new upper level framed and sheathed, along with the new porch structure, stairs, and railings taking shape. This was the kind of project that required careful planning from the structure out, because the goal was not just to add square footage, but to make the finished home feel cohesive, solid, and properly built from the ground up.
